Appropriate Preposition:

  • Vary from ( আলাদা হওয়া ) His opinion varies from his brother's.
  • Quick at ( চটপটে ) He is quick at figures.
  • Anxious about ( উদ্বিগ্ন ) I am anxious about my health.
  • Preferable to ( অধিক পছন্দযোগ্য ) Death is preferable to dishonor.
  • Warn of ( সতর্ক করা ) He warned me of the danger.
  • Partial to ( পক্ষপাত দুষ্ট ) He is partial to his son.

Idioms:

  • Apple of discord ( বিবাদেয় বিষয় ) The paternal property has become an apple of discord between the two brothers.
  • Get rid of ( মুক্তি পাওয়া ) Try to get rid of that rogue.
  • Stick to ( দৃঢ়ভাবে লেগে থাকা ) He sticks to his decision.
  • All but ( প্রায় ) The poor villagers are all but ruined.
  • Bed of roses ( আরামদায়ক অবস্থা ) Life is not a bed of roses.
  • All at once ( হঠাৎ ) All at once a tiger came out of the forest.
